2026 Senate Bill 948

Labor: fair employment practices; requirement for an employee to access or respond to work-related communications outside of usual work hours; prohibit.

A bill to prohibit employers from requiring certain employees to access certain communications at certain times; to prohibit retaliation; to prohibit certain waivers; to provide remedies; to provide for the powers and duties of certain state and local governmental officers and entities; and to require the promulgation of rules.
